Community and Voluntary Sector Collaboration

Get Nottinghamshire Connected are offering grants of up to £5000 to local Community and Voluntary Sector Organisations and groups across Nottingham and Nottinghamshire that are keen to embed digital skills support into the great work they’re already doing.

This funding may be for you, if your organisation can; 

  • Help people to understand the relevance of digital to them
  • Help people to understand the types of things they can do online
  • Help people to improve their digital confidence
  • Improve awareness of and support to access to health and care services
  • Find opportunities in conversations to introduce users to relevant health information

The Approach 

We understand that the best people to help those who are digitally excluded are those who are embedded within local communities and already supporting people in other aspects of their daily lives. People need trusted, familiar faces who offer the right support at the right time. 

Our localised collaboration approach focuses on building relationships across health and care providers and third sector organisations. Through partnership working with organisations and communities we hope to increase the provision of digital access, skills, and support available locally.

Organisations are asked to trial and test delivery models for a minimum of 6 months. The support models you put in place can be unique and responsive to your local residents needs, wants and interests.

The impact 

Find out more about the organisations who have taken part or are delivering support in their local area

Ashfield Voluntary Action ran delivery models from October 2020 - May 2021

Throughout the projects timeframe they have;

  • Supported 95 local residents to get online and improve their skills and confidence using digital
  • Delivered 20 digital skill sessions to support people in improving their Digital skills and confidence
  • Recruited 12 people to become digital champions within their local communities
